mysticism
mysticism 英 [ˈmɪstɪsɪzəm] 美 [ˈmɪstɪˌsɪzəm]
n. 神秘;神秘主义;谬论
名词复数:mysticisms
- Mysticism is a religion or religious belief based on union or communion with a deity, or divine being. Mysticism is what lets you transcend the physical to experience enlightenment — let's just say you'll recognize it when it happens.
